ISO 27001 Audit
Information security management system (ISMS) requirements are outlined in ISO 27001, the only globally accepted auditable standard. A set of policies, processes, standards, and systems that regulate risks to information security such malware, data breaches, cyber-attacks, and theft is known as an information security management system (ISMS).
An organization's definition and implementation of best practices for information security procedures are demonstrated by its ISO 27001 audit. Some organizations use ISO 27001 as an outline for a best-practice strategy to information security, while others opt to become certified.

Prevent the monetary fines and damages brought on by data breaches.
According to IBM's 2022 Cost of a Data Breach, the median expense of a data breach has increased to $4.35 million worldwide, a 12.7% rise from 2020. The international standard for efficient information management is ISO 27001. It assists businesses in avoiding potentially expensive security lapses.
Businesses with ISO 27001 certification can demonstrate to clients, partners, and shareholders how they have taken precautions against data breaches. This might lessen the harm a data breach does to one's finances and reputation.
